作为一名网络工程师,我经常遇到用户在使用VPN(虚拟私人网络)时出现“连接成功但无网络”或“无法访问互联网”的问题,这不仅影响工作效率,也可能导致数据传输失败或安全风险,本文将从原理出发,系统性地分析可能原因,并提供实用的排查步骤和解决方案。
理解基本原理至关重要,当用户连接到VPN时,设备会创建一条加密隧道,所有流量通过该隧道转发至远程服务器,如果此过程出错,本地网络可能仍能正常工作(如局域网内通信),但无法访问公网资源(如网页、邮件等),常见故障点包括路由配置错误、DNS解析异常、防火墙拦截、以及服务器端限制。
第一步:确认是否真正连通了VPN,许多用户误以为“状态显示已连接”就等于网络可用,建议执行以下操作:
- 在命令行中输入
ping 8.8.8.8(Google DNS)测试基础连通性; - 若无法ping通,则说明VPN隧道未正确建立,需检查证书、账号密码、协议类型(如OpenVPN、IKEv2、L2TP/IPSec)是否匹配;
- 使用
tracert或traceroute命令查看路径是否中断,判断是在本地还是远端节点断开。
第二步:检查DNS设置,很多情况下,虽然隧道通了,但DNS解析失败导致无法加载网站,解决方法如下:
- 手动修改本地DNS为公共DNS(如1.1.1.1、8.8.8.8);
- 在VPN客户端中启用“使用远程DNS”选项(部分软件支持);
- 若使用Windows系统,可在“网络适配器属性”中重置DNS优先级。
第三步:防火墙与杀毒软件干扰,企业环境常部署严格的网络安全策略,个人设备也可能因杀毒软件误判而阻断流量,请尝试:
- 暂时关闭防火墙或杀毒软件测试;
- 添加VPN程序到白名单;
- 检查是否有IPsec或IKEv2相关端口被封锁(如UDP 500、4500)。
第四步:服务器端限制,有些免费或企业级VPN服务商对并发连接、带宽或地理位置有限制,可联系客服确认:
- 是否存在限速或地域封锁;
- 是否需要更换服务器节点;
- 是否需要升级账户权限。
若上述均无效,建议重置网络配置:
- Windows用户可运行
netsh winsock reset和ipconfig /release && ipconfig /renew; - macOS/Linux 用户可重启网络服务或清除缓存DNS。
VPN连接后无网络并非单一故障,而是多层因素叠加的结果,作为网络工程师,我们应具备系统思维——从链路层到应用层逐级排查,才能快速定位并解决问题,日常维护中,定期更新客户端、保持系统补丁及时、合理配置策略,是预防此类问题的关键,如果你正在经历类似困扰,请按本文步骤逐一验证,相信很快就能恢复畅通网络!

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速






